# DNS resolution to the Quillmere registry is flaky under load. Symptom:
# intermittent SERVFAIL, then a burst of timeouts. Root cause upstream;
# not fixable here. Mitigation: cache positive results aggressively,
# cache negatives briefly, retry with jitter. Plugins must NOT implement
# their own resolution — use this module or you'll double the retry storm.
# Do not raise the retry cap; the registry rate-limits by source and will
# blackhole you. Values below were validated in the Harrowgate soak test.
# Current constants:

tuning table, yajog-yahof:
BUDGETS = {
    "lamvan": 303,
    "wenox": 460,
    "fenvan": 525,
}

Subject: Handover — Pixelbin cache leak

Hey Dorit,

Passing the Pixelbin image-cache leak to you before I'm out. The cache service slowly eats memory over about 48 hours, then the box tips over. Restarting buys time but doesn't fix it. I suspect thumbnails aren't being evicted after the resize job fails. The eviction log lives in the ops database — easiest way to dig in is to connect directly with this string.

replica DSN, kajep-yahag: mssql://praok_svc:iF@db-8d68.plorvaio.local:5432/eliion

# Vendor Note: Skylark Migrations

Skylark Systems handles our zero-downtime schema migrations under the Driftless contract. They require 48 hours notice before any release touching the Ordervault schema. Expand-contract only; no in-place column changes. Their SLA covers rollback within 30 minutes. Schedule migration windows through their coordinator.

escalation mailbox, bafog-fafog: ulador@paliqlabs.internal